Playful, riotous and unapologetic, with lashings of oversharing, Egyptian-Sudanese singer-songwriter Nxdia’s powerful nature runs through every vein of their alt-pop signature. Born inCairo and Manchester raised, Nxdia came into songwritingearly in life by pouring their feelingsinto poetry and music to process the world around them, while yearning for a community to fitinto.
From queer awakening anthem‘She Likes A Boy’and intoxicating queer love anthem‘More!”toexploring the emotional whiplash of feeling everything and nothing in‘Feel Anything’and punk-pop banger‘Boy Clothes’in which they explore their experience of gender dysphoria and thefreedom of gender expression,-Nxdia is unravelling their own vulnerabilities to connect withothers. Nxdia released their critically-acclaimed debut mixtape“I Promise No One’s Watching”in June.
